About

Sergei Karnup is a scholar working on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, Cognitive Neuroscience and Urology. According to data from OpenAlex, Sergei Karnup has authored 41 papers receiving a total of 1.6k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 22 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, 18 papers in Cognitive Neuroscience and 11 papers in Urology. Recurrent topics in Sergei Karnup's work include Neural dynamics and brain function (15 papers),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(14 papers) and Neuroscience and Neural Engineering (11 papers). Sergei Karnup is often cited by papers focused on Neural dynamics and brain function (15 papers),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(14 papers) and Neuroscience and Neural Engineering (11 papers). Sergei Karnup collaborates with scholars based in United States, Russia and Japan. Sergei Karnup's co-authors include Abdallah Hayar, Michael T. Shipley, Matthew Ennis, Armin Stelzer, Jason Aungst, Gábor Szabó, Adam C. Puché, Philip M. Heyward, Edgar Buhl and Péter Somogyi and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Neuron and Journal of Neuroscience.
